TCP/IP:
TCP stands for Transmission Control Protocol and IP stands for Internet Protocol. Internet uses the TCP/IP suite which is a collection of protocol standards, to implement the four-level communication hierarchy. TCP/IP provides more than one ways to implement the transport layer. So, TCP is defined a version of transport layer.
